Statutory Instrument 1998 No. 2194The Land Authority for Wales (Transfer of Staff) Order 1998(The document as of February, 2008) STATUTORY INSTRUMENTS1998 No. 2194The Land Authority for Wales (Transfer of Staff) Order 1998
The Secretary of State for Wales, in exercise of the powers conferred on him by sections 136(4) and (5) and 154(1), (5) and (6) of the Government of Wales Act 1998[1] and of all other powers enabling him in that behalf, hereby makes the following Order:- 1.This Order may be cited as the Land Authority for Wales (Transfer of Staff) Order 1998 and shall come into force on 1st October 1998. 2.In this Order-
3.The contract of employment between a relevant employee and the Authority shall have effect on and after the transfer date as if originally made between that employee and the Agency.
(b) anything done before the transfer date by, or in relation to, the Authority in respect of the contract of employment or the relevant employee, shall be deemed from that date to have been done by or in relation to the Agency. 5.Nothing in this order affects any right of a relevant employee to terminate his contract of employment if a substantial change is made in his working conditions, to his detriment, but no such right shall arise by reason only of the change of employer effected by this order. (This note does not form part of the Order) This order provides, in article 3, for the transfer of staff from the Land Authority for Wales, on the cessation of its functions, to the Welsh Development Agency with effect from 1st October 1998. Article 4 provides for the transfer to the Agency of all rights and liabilities of the Authority under existing contracts of employment and preserves in effect anything done prior to the transfer date in relation to any contract of employment. Article 5 preserves the right of any employee to terminate his contract of employment if there is a substantial change, to his detriment, in his working conditions.
